Frequently Asked Questions
What are the most common DTF transfer problems and how can a DTF transfer troubleshooting guide help you fix DTF transfers and DTF printing issues?
Common DTF transfer problems include misregistration, faded or weak color, color bleeding, peeling, cracking, sticky film, and texture changes after washing. A structured DTF transfers troubleshooting guide helps by: 1) validating design and alignment; 2) calibrating the printer and color management (ICC profiles); 3) inspecting film and adhesive powder quality; 4) optimizing heat press parameters (temperature, time, pressure) for the garment; 5) ensuring proper drying and curing. Use one-variable-at-a-time testing and wash tests to confirm fixes and build a reliable baseline for future DTF transfers.
What DTF heat press tips from a DTF transfer troubleshooting guide can help you fix adhesion and color issues and prevent misregistration?
DTF heat press tips to improve adhesion and color fidelity include: pre-press to remove moisture and flatten fibers; apply even, full-area pressure with the correct temperature and time for your film and fabric; use alignment guides or a jig to prevent misregistration; use protective sheets to prevent scorching; allow the print to cool before handling; store film and adhesive powder properly to avoid moisture; run a test print and a wash test, then adjust settings in small increments. Following these DTF transfer troubleshooting steps reduces peeling, sticky film, and color loss on a wide range of fabrics.
| Topic | Key Points |
|---|---|
| Introduction | DTF transfers offer color depth and a soft hand; troubleshooting minimizes waste and material loss; a systematic workflow improves reliability across cotton, polyester, and blends. |
| Common DTF Transfer Problems | Problems fall into image quality, adhesion, and post-press performance. Examples include misregistration, faded color, bleeding, peeling, edge cracking, sticky film, and post-wash texture changes. |
| Diagnosing Causes | Record symptoms, review design, and test one variable at a time. Assess print quality, substrate, pre-treatment/film, printer/color management, heat press parameters, and curing. |
| Step-by-Step Troubleshooting Process | 1) Validate design; 2) Calibrate printer; 3) Inspect film/adhesive; 4) Optimize print settings; 5) Align transfer; 6) Pre-press prep; 7) Press and cure; 8) Cool and post-press care; 9) Wash tests and feedback. |
| Best Practices for Reliable DTF Transfers | Fabric compatibility, consistent pre-treatment, quality film/powder, regular printer maintenance, controlled environment, testing/documentation, and clear post-press care with customer education. |
| Common Scenarios and Practical Fixes | Colors washed out; transfer peels after washing; misregistered designs; film feels sticky. Fixes include adjusting ink density and curing, improving adhesion, aligning properly, drying pre-press, and verifying film/ink compatibility. |
| Troubleshooting Checklist for DTF Transfers | Design size/alignment, printer calibration/color profiles, film/adhesion/storage checks, print settings/resolution, pre-press moisture removal, even heat/time/pressure, cooling, wash tests, and parameter refinement. |
